About the Book

The Art of Interviewing: A Comprehensive Guide to Interviewing, Communication, Storytelling, and Influence Empower job seekers, educators, workforce program facilitators and participants with the ultimate tool for success in today's competitive job market. Whether you're leading a career and technical education (CTE) program, managing a workforce readiness initiative, or preparing individuals to confidently pursue their professional dreams, The Art of Interviewing is the must-have resource to achieve your goals. This comprehensive guide is designed to address the evolving needs of job seekers and those guiding them, providing actionable strategies to navigate the job search process, sharpen interpersonal skills, and relationship management. The Art of Interviewing is perfect for: State workforce readiness programs seeking resources to educate and empower program participants. School districts focused on preparing students for internships, college, and career paths. Corporations focused on providing leadership development and training to enhance team communication, boost leader confidence, and support internal career growth. Why should your organization invest in this essential resource? For CTE Programs and Educators: Equip teachers with tools to effectively prepare students for real-world career challenges. From crafting standout resumes to mastering soft skills, this book empowers educators to integrate professional development into their curricula seamlessly. For Workforce and Job Readiness Programs: Provide participants with practical, easy-to-follow strategies that enhance their confidence and competitiveness, from building a professional online presence to confidently tell their stories during interviews using the STAR Method. For Corporations: Strengthen your internal talent pipeline by equipping employees to successfully interview for internal opportunities and refine their interpersonal communication skills. This book fosters improved team dynamics and prepares staff for career progression within your organization, boosting overall performance and engagement. For Individuals Pursuing Career Success: Whether a seasoned professional or a first-time job seeker, this book delivers transformative insights to help them "ace their interview like a boss." Inside the book, you'll find: Engaging tools for professional storytelling to stand out in any interview. Step-by-step strategies for leveraging social media to build a compelling personal brand. A library of 45 essential interview questions and communication templates to eliminate guesswork and inspire success. Pro tips from Ebony, who has guided countless individuals and organizations toward career excellence. Ebony, an experienced executive coach and consultant, offering actionable insights rooted in years of expertise. Ebony has been featured in O, The Oprah Magazine, Essence, Huffington Post, and Black Enterprise and is a sought-after facilitator for leadership development and career training programs.
